Subject: Bugzilla white board and dates

When adding dates to the whiteboard, please use the following format:
(DD-MMM-YYYY) eg. (18-AUG-2011)
It can be very confusing when people use DD-MM and MM-DD, depending on
their locale. For DD < 13, you can't determine which format was used.
